PentiumŪ III and
PentiumŪ II processor-based ATX motherboard supporting 66-MHz
and 100-MHz System Buses
The Intel SE440BX-2 motherboard delivers 100-MHz system level bandwidth to optimize the performance of IntelŪ PentiumŪ III processors 500 MHz or 450 MHz and PentiumŪ II processors 450 MHz, 400 MHz, or 350 MHz. With support for the Accelerated Graphics Port and the increased throughput of the 100-MHz system bus, the SE440BX-2 motherboard delivers enhanced system performance for the demanding system applications of today and tomorrow.
Increased system performance with the 100-MHz system bus
The SE440BX-2 motherboard features the Intel 440BX AGPset which supports a 100-MHz system bus, improving the bandwidth between the PentiumŪ III and Pentium II processor, Accelerated Graphics Port, 100-MHz SDRAM, and PCI bus. The result is significantly enhanced media and graphics performance. Home PC users will enjoy improved texture rendering in 3D software, including games, entertainment, educational and digital-imaging applications. Business PC users will appreciate smooth performance in such 3D applications as CAD programs, as well as in sophisticated data visualization and web-authoring tools.
Ultimate Design Flexibility
The SE440BX-2 motherboard also provides OEMs and system integrators with maximum design flexibility by supporting both 66-MHz and 100-MHz system designs. This flexible platform accomodates different memory and processor combinations, allowing 100-MHz components to be added as needed -- even at a later date. Moreover, the SE440BX-2 motherboard is designed to meet the demanding needs of multiple end-users. The board features an on-board hardware management ASIC, Wake on LAN* header, and Intel's LANDeskŪ Virus Protect software to lower the total cost of ownership. The SE440BX-2 motherboard also offers optional integrated Yamaha* PCI audio for an exceptional AC'97 audio subsystem.
| SE440BX-2 Features | SE440BX-2 Benefits |
| IntelŪ PentiumŪ III, IntelŪ PentiumŪ II and IntelŪ Celeron™ processor support | Optimized system performance when using Pentium III processors 500 MHz and 450 MHz, and Pentium II processors 450 MHz, 400 MHz, 350 MHz, 300 MHz, 266 MHz, and 233 MHz. Flexibility to support Celeron processors 400 MHz, 366 MHz, 333 MHz, 300A MHz, 300 MHz, and 266 MHz. |
| 440BX AGPset | Flexibility to support both 66-MHz and 100-MHz system designs |
| Three 168 pin DIMM sockets | Supports up to 768 MB of SDRAM |
| Hardware Management ASIC WfM1.1a Compliant | Remote monitoring of system conditions for lower total cost of ownership |
| Ultra DMA/33 | Faster disk with I/O with improved data integrity |
| AC'97 (PCI) Audio | Exceptional integrated audio subsystem with improved signal to noise ratio |
| Universal Serial Bus (USB) connectors | Expand and simplify PC connectivity while enabling new peripherals |
